Installation Tips for Metallic Ceramic Tiles
Installing metallic ceramic tiles is similar to installing regular ceramic tiles, but a few extra precautions will ensure a professional-looking finish. First, ensure you have a perfectly level and clean subfloor or wall. Any imperfections will be magnified by the metallic surface, making them more noticeable.
When cutting metallic tiles, use a wet saw with a diamond blade specifically designed for cutting glass and ceramic. This will minimize chipping and ensure clean, precise cuts. Remember to wear safety glasses to protect your eyes from flying debris.
Grouting is crucial! Choose a grout color that complements the metallic tone of your tiles. Epoxy grout is a great option for its durability and resistance to stains, especially in high-traffic areas. Apply the grout carefully, ensuring it fills all the joints completely.
Finally, cleaning is key to maintaining the luster of your metallic ceramic tiles. Avoid har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ners, as these can scratch the surface and dull the finish. Instead, use a mild detergent and a soft cloth to gently clean the tiles. Buff dry with a clean, dry cloth to enhance the shine.
Maintaining the Shine and Longevity of Your Metallic Ceramic Tiles
Like any investment in your home, your metallic ceramic tiles require a little care to keep them looking their best for years to come. A simple routine cleaning can go a long way in preventing dirt and grime from building up and dulling the metallic sheen. Think of it like washing your car – regular washes keep it looking its best.
Protect your tiles from scratches by using floor mats at entryways and felt pads under furniture. Sand and dirt tracked indoors can act as abrasives, gradually scratching the tile surface over time. These simple precautions can significantly extend the life of your tiles.
Spills should be cleaned up immediately to prevent staining. While many metallic ceramic tiles are stain-resistant, certain liquids, especially acidic ones, can potentially etch or discolor the surface if left unattended for too long. A quick wipe with a damp cloth is usually all it takes.
Consider sealing your metallic ceramic tiles, especially if they are installed in a high-moisture area like a bathroom or kitchen. Sealing provides an extra layer of protection against water damage and staining, ensuring that your tiles retain their beauty for years to come. Consult with a tile professional to determine the best sealant for your specific type of tile.

4. Understanding the Ceramic Tile Grade and Durability
Ceramic tiles are graded based on their hardness, water absorption, and resistance to abrasion. The Porcelain Enamel Institute (PEI) rating measures a tile’s resistance to surface abrasion, with higher ratings indicating greater durability. For high-traffic areas like hallways and kitchens, you’ll want to choose tiles with a higher PEI rating to ensure they can withstand daily wear and tear.
Water absorption is another crucial factor to consider, especially for bathrooms and kitchens. Tiles with low water absorption are more resistant to staining and cracking, making them ideal for wet environments. Look for tiles that are labeled as “impervious” or “vitreous,” which indicate a low water absorption rate. Also, check the tile’s slip resistance rating, particularly for flooring applications, to prevent accidents. Selecting the best metallic ceramic tiles means prioritizing durability and safety, especially in areas prone to moisture or heavy foot traffic.

6. Considering Grout Color and Installation
Grout plays a significant role in the overall look of your tiled surface. The color and width of the grout lines can either highlight or downplay the tiles, so it’s essential to choose wisely. A contrasting grout color can emphasize the individual tiles and create a more graphic look, while a matching grout color can blend the tiles together for a seamless appearance.
Also, consider the width of the grout lines. Narrow grout lines can create a more modern and minimalist look, while wider grout lines can add a touch of rustic charm. What exactly are metallic ceramic tiles, and how are they different from regular ceramic tiles?
Metallic ceramic tiles aren’t actually made of metal, which is a common misconception! They’re ceramic tiles that are designed to look like metal. Manufacturers achieve this metallic look by using special glazes or printing techniques that mimic the appearance of materials like steel, bronze, copper, or even gold. The result is a tile that has the durability and water resistance of ceramic but with the stylish and modern aesthetic of metal.
So, the key difference is the visual effect. Regular ceramic tiles come in a wide variety of colors and patterns, but they don’t typically try to replicate the look of metal. Metallic ceramic tiles are all about bringing that industrial chic or elegant sheen into your space without the potential drawbacks of using actual metal, like susceptibility to rust or higher costs.

Do metallic ceramic tiles scratch easily?
The scratch resistance of metallic ceramic tiles depends on the quality and type of tile you choose. Generally, ceramic tiles are pretty durable, but the metallic glaze can be more susceptible to scratches than the base ceramic material. Look for tiles with a good PEI rating, as mentioned earlier, which indicates their resistance to abrasion.
Also, consider the type of metallic effect. Some finishes, like brushed metal looks, might be better at hiding minor scratches than highly polished, mirror-like surfaces. Taking preventative measures, like using rugs in high-traffic areas and avoiding the use of abrasive cleaners, will also help to keep your tiles looking their best for years to come.
